The ingredients needed to cook Steak Enchiladas:
  1. Use Corn tortillas
  2. Provide 2-3 cups cooked beef steak, I used top sirloin, chopped small
  3. Prepare Refried beans
  4. Get lEnchilada sauce
  5. Use Shredded cheese
Instructions to make Steak Enchiladas:
  1. Preheat oven to 350. Spray thoroughly a 9x13 baking dish. In a skillet on high heat crisp and brown the steak. I added the drippings from the night before and reduced it.
  2. On a tortilla, put a spoon of beans, a spoon of steak, and a sprinkling of cheese. Roll it up and place seam side down. Continue rolling until your dish is full. Pour sauce over all of it.
  3. I baked it covered for about 30 minutes. Took it out and uncovered it and sprinkled more cheese on top. Returned it to the oven for a few minutes then took it out and let it sit for a bit. Served with sour cream and all the good fixins
